Halo 3: ODST is coming to PC on September 22nd

Microsoft has announced that Halo 3: ODST will be coming to PC on September 22nd as part of The Master Chief Collection, making the game available on Steam, the Microsoft Store and through Xbox Game Pass for PC. 

On PC, Halo ODST will support 4K resolutions, Ultrawide displays, 60 FPS framerates and support graphical settings which go beyond what was available with the game’s original Xbox release. FOV customisation, mouse/keyboard support and more will help further differentiate this game from its original Xbox 360 release. 

With this release, Halo 3: ODST’s Firefight mode will be coming to The Master Chief Collection on all platforms, enabling 4-player co-op on dedicated servers across ten legacy maps. 

Halo 4 will be the next game to arrive as part of Halo: The Master Chief Collection, after which, Halo 5: Guardians will be the only Halo title to lack a PC release. At this time, Microsoft has not revealed any official plans to bring Halo 5 to PC.
